Can I use my credit card without activating it?

What happens if you don’t activate a credit card. Your account is considered open from the date you’re approved for the card. If you don’t activate your card your account will still be open, you just won’t be able to use it.

What happens if I never activate my credit one card?

You should be aware that if you don’t activate your card within 14 days after you receive it, Credit One will automatically close the new account. Similarly, once you’re approved for a card, Credit One will report the new account to the major credit bureaus, regardless of whether you activate the card.

Can I use my Old Navy credit card at Walmart?

Yes, you can use your Old Navy Credit Card anywhere Mastercard is accepted, and that’s pretty much anywhere that takes credit cards. More specifically, your Old Navy Credit Card is accepted at 10.7 million U.S. merchant locations and in more than 210 countries.

Is it hard to get an Old Navy credit card?

A fair credit score is usually necessary to get approved for a store credit card with Old Navy. The Old Navy Visa® Card has stricter requirements since it can be used outside of Gap Inc. brands. You will likely need a good credit score — a FICO® Score of 670, or close to that number to qualify.

How many credit cards should I have to build credit?

Credit bureaus suggest that five or more accounts — which can be a mix of cards and loans — is a reasonable number to build toward over time. Having very few accounts can make it hard for scoring models to render a score for you.

Does not activating a credit card hurt your credit?

1. Simply applying for credit can impact your credit score. First, even though you need to activate the card in order to make purchases with it, whether or not you activate a credit card does not have an effect on your credit score.

Does your credit score go down if you don’t use it?

Credit scoring models also need to see activity in the account to include it in your score calculation. If you haven’t used the card for a number of months, it might show too little activity be included, which can result in a credit score drop.

Is it better to cancel a credit card or just not use it?

In general, it’s best to keep unused credit cards open so that you benefit from a longer average credit history and a larger amount of available credit. Credit scoring models reward you for having long-standing credit accounts, and for using only a small portion of your credit limit.

Do you have to pay annual fee on credit card if you don’t use it?

It’s important to remember that the annual fee immediately gets added to your account’s balance. Even if you don’t use your card for purchases, make sure you pay your bill on time to avoid getting charged a late payment fee as well.
